Copy page URL Share on Twitter Share on WhatsApp Share on Facebook
Get it on Google Play
Meaning of word tread-wheel from English dictionary with examples, synonyms and antonyms.

tread-wheel   noun

Meaning : A mill that is powered by men or animals walking on a circular belt or climbing steps.

Synonyms : treadmill, treadwheel